概括
在RNA测序 (RNA-seq) 中的基因组DNA污染可能会扭曲结果. CleanUpRNAseq有效地检测和纠正这种污染,提高了宝贵的RNA样本的基因表达分析准确度.
科学领域:
- 分子生物学分子生物学
- 生物信息学是一种生物信息学.
- 基因组学就是基因组学.
背景情况:
- RNA测序 (RNA-seq) 对于基因表达造型至关重要.
- 在RNA-seq库中的基因组DNA (gDNA) 污染损害了数据完整性.
- 准确的分析至关重要,特别是对于稀缺的RNA样本.
研究的目的:
- 开发和验证一种工具,用于检测和纠正RNA-seq数据中的gDNA污染.
- 为了解决现有的gDNA污染纠正方法的局限性.
- 通过确保其完整性来增强RNA-seq数据的实用性.
主要方法:
- 开发了带有多个校正算法的CleanUpRNAseq软件包.
- 针对串串和不串串的RNA-seq数据实施不同的校正策略.
- 严格验证使用公开数据集与已知的污染水平和现实世界的数据.
主要成果:
- 在各种RNA-seq库协议中,CleanUpRNAseq有效地识别和纠正gDNA污染.
- 已证明有效改善链链和非链链RNA-seq. 的数据质量.
- 验证证实了该工具在不同数据集上的性能.
结论:
- CleanUpRNAseq是RNA-seq.在RNA-seq.中对对齐后质量控制的一个有价值的工具.
- 建议将其整合到常规工作流程中,例如OneStopRNAseq.
- 该包显著提高了基因表达和差异表达分析的准确性.

RNA sequencing, or RNA-Seq, is a high-throughput sequencing technology used to study the transcriptome of a cell. Transcriptomics helps to interpret the functional elements of a genome and identify the molecular constituents of an organism. Additionally, it also helps in understanding the development of an organism and the occurrence of diseases.

The Upf proteins that carry out nonsense-mediated decay (NMD) are found in all eukaryotic organisms, including humans. Each protein has an individual role, but they need to work in collaboration. Upf1 is an ATP-dependent RNA helicase that unwinds the RNA helix. Because Upf1 can unwind any RNA, Upf2 and Upf3 are required to help Upf1 discriminate between nonsense and normal mRNAs.
